NSW Territory Manager– Footwear and Outdoor Brands

We are seeking an experienced Territory Sales Manager to join our team at Phoenix Leisure Group. Based in our Sydney office and managing our NSW account base, this position would be ideal for a self-motivated, highly organized individual who is passionate about camping, hiking and life in the outdoors.

Respon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Manage the established NSW wholesale customer base across the portfolio of outdoor hard goods and outdoor footwear brands distributed by Phoenix Leisure Group nationally
  • Be the key contact for the wholesale customer base across the territory.
  • Identify and develop new business opportunities within the territory
  • Be a product expert, have an intimate knowledge of all products across all brands
  • Work to deadlines and order cut-off dates
  • Provide regular progress reports and commentary regarding Sales performance by account and brand
  • Provide in-store support as required for all National accounts
  • Provide regular feedback to the Sales Manager regarding seasonal range and future product development opportunities
  • Provide regular input and competitive analysis across all categories and brands.
  • Identify and implement account-specific marketing support programs
  • Identify and implement account-specific staff training programs
